About the blog

This site began as a course blog for a seminar I taught in 2015 called “Truth in Media.”

I’ve since re-named and retooled the site to share out glimpses into the classes, student work, and educational philosophy of Loudoun School for the Gifted. 

The site name, “Essential Questions,” refers to the organizing principle of our classes: intellectually-worthwhile, broadly-resonant inquiry that transcends any particular course or text. I also mean to suggest that we are still in the process of continually questioning, experimenting with and reflecting on our work as teachers and administrators.
